Output d040c049323a54236a6f8930e6ed4a8094a2e8563f5957fd671130b80aa22039:0

value
83000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8ad20c897fda0b8df2f6345041d714a19564b6a OP_EQUAL
address
3MShH8Mkccg6PPZ58PKUgyuofjhNjdpxuM
transaction
d040c049323a54236a6f8930e6ed4a8094a2e8563f5957fd671130b80aa22039
confirmations
404861
spent
true